William Casarin 3d18db8fd2 Fullscreen MediaViewer refactor
- Moved media related logic into notedeck instead of the ui crate,
  since they pertain to Images/ImageCache based systems

- Made RenderableMedia owned to make it less of a nightmware
  to work with and the perf should be negligible

- Added a ImageMetadata cache to Images. This is referenced
  whenever we encounter an image so we don't have to
  redo the work all of the time

- Relpaced our ad-hoc, hand(vibe?)-coded panning and zoom logic
  with the Scene widget, which is explicitly designed for
  this use case

- Extracted and detangle fullscreen media rendering from inside of note
  rendering.  We instead let the application decide what action they
  want to perform when note media is clicked on.

- We add an on_view_media action to MediaAction for the application to
  handle. The Columns app uses this toggle a FullscreenMedia app
  option bits whenever we get a MediaAction::ViewMedis(urls).

pub mod anim;
pub mod app_images;
pub mod colors;
pub mod constants;
pub mod context_menu;
pub mod icons;
pub mod images;
pub mod media;
pub mod mention;
pub mod note;
pub mod profile;
mod username;
pub mod widgets;
pub use anim::{AnimationHelper, PulseAlpha};
pub use mention::Mention;
pub use note::{NoteContents, NoteOptions, NoteView};
pub use profile::{ProfilePic, ProfilePreview};
pub use username::Username;
use egui::{Label, Margin, RichText};
/// This is kind of like the Widget trait but is meant for larger top-level
/// views that are typically stateful.
///
/// The Widget trait forces us to add mutable
/// implementations at the type level, which screws us when generating Previews
/// for a Widget. I would have just Widget instead of making this Trait otherwise.
///
/// There is some precendent for this, it looks like there's a similar trait
/// in the egui demo library.
pub trait View {
fn ui(&mut self, ui: &mut egui::Ui);
}
pub fn padding<R>(
amount: impl Into<Margin>,
ui: &mut egui::Ui,
add_contents: impl FnOnce(&mut egui::Ui) -> R,
) -> egui::InnerResponse<R> {
egui::Frame::new()
.inner_margin(amount)
.show(ui, add_contents)
}
pub fn hline(ui: &egui::Ui) {
hline_with_width(ui, ui.available_rect_before_wrap().x_range());
}
pub fn hline_with_width(ui: &egui::Ui, range: egui::Rangef) {
// pixel perfect horizontal line
let rect = ui.available_rect_before_wrap();
#[allow(deprecated)]
let resize_y = ui.painter().round_to_pixel(rect.top()) - 0.5;
let stroke = ui.style().visuals.widgets.noninteractive.bg_stroke;
ui.painter().hline(range, resize_y, stroke);
}
pub fn secondary_label(ui: &mut egui::Ui, s: impl Into<String>) {
let color = ui.style().visuals.noninteractive().fg_stroke.color;
ui.add(Label::new(RichText::new(s).size(10.0).color(color)).selectable(false));
}
